Configuring Disk Drives, Disk Arrays, and CD-ROM Drives
5 Configuring Disk Drives, Disk
Arrays, and CD-ROM Drives
This chapter gives procedures and guidelines for configuring hard and
floppy disk drives and disk arrays to SCSI interfaces. Procedures and
guidelines are also provided for configuring CD-ROM drives to SCSI
interfaces.
When configuring a disk drive, disk array, or CD-ROM drive, have
available the following additional documentation:
Managing Systems and Workgroups
HP-UX Reference
Pertinent hardware documentation for the computer, device adapter,
and peripheral device
Record of your disk configuration
NOTE You can use /usr/sbin/ioscan -C disk to identify disks configured on
your system. You can use /usr/sbin/diskinfo to find out disk
characteristics. Once you have configured a disk and are creating a file
system, HP-UX uses the correct disk geometry, without requiring you to
cite an explicit /etc/disktab entry. For backward compatibility, you can
still consult /etc/disktab for disk geometry information on older disks.
